Abstract

A stable, hermetically sealed, partially optically transparent package for use to protect optoelectronic components is provided. The package has good cooling for the installed circuit elements and is as stable in relation to temperature and UV. The package has a cap with a frame made of a nitride ceramic and a glass element. The frame has an opening and the glass element hermetically closes the opening. The glass is fused onto the nitride ceramic and is fixed in contact with the nitride ceramic of the frame.
